Hey folks, 66 here. Got hit with Mantle Cell Lymphoma about 7 years back and have been keeping an eye on it with regular blood tests. Then, boom, a couple of weeks ago, this big lump just showed up out of nowhere. My doc's talking about starting chemo and laid out my options: Rituximab with Bendamustine or throwing Cytarabine into the mix as well. If anyone's been down this road and can share their experience or advice, I'd really appreciate it. Thanks a ton!

      There are many different treatments available however it depends on your unique situation as to what one will benefit you the most. I think the most impotant thing you can do if you have not already is find a MCL specialist. They can match you to treatment by your biomarkers and your unique MCL much better than a general oncologist can . Hoping you get the right answers

      I went through a treatment mix of Velcade, Rituxan, Cyclophosphamide, Adriamycin, and prednisone, and honestly, it did wonders for me. By the end of my treatment, my PET scan was all clear, showing a complete response. Now, I'm on Rituximab as my maintenance treatment.

"Rituximab and Bendamustine are often used together as a standard treatment for mantle cell lymphoma, and adding cytarabine can enhance the effectiveness of the regimen in some cases. However, the choice ultimately depends on various histological disease factors, the stage of your disease, your overall health, and potential side effects. It's important to discuss with your doctor about the pros and cons and how they fit your individual situation. Some patients have reported side effects like mouth sores, flu-like symptoms, headaches, hair loss and generally an increased risk of infections from using Cytarabine."
